Post by: Grim 82 on May 26, 2011, 11:33:41 am
I would guess that at a minimum you should be able to get 10 mpg, depending on many variables. Lots of members here are reporting 15 or better with their 454's. What carb do you have on it, and how is the condition of everything as far as tune-up parts? You can lean out your mixture at the carb pretty easily, but you may need to re-jet, etc. to get it perfect. Make sure your timing is dialed in, lean out your fuel mixture and make sure to clean or replace your plugs. After running rich for an extended time they are probably looking pretty nasty.

I've gotten 15.8 mpg traveling 60 mph on the interstate with my 454 C20 4 speed with the 3.21 gear out back so it is possible.  Bone stock with 127K miles and all the emission controls still on the truck.

With the carb needing a rebuild because of starting issues and the fuel-air mixture screws still plugged I get a solid 13 country driving.  Pulling a car trailer it drops to 11.

I once got 13.8 steady 60mph,A/C off, flat country, all highway. I have 3.73s, th400, and all stock w/ a quadrajet needing repair.  When I towed my 40' 12,000lb bumper pull camper I got 5-6, not bad.  Reckon ethanol free gasoline makes a difference on these rigs?  I know it makes about a 10% difference on my 01 Toyota 4.7
